Short Summary

Amr Diab is a renowned Egyptian singer and composer, celebrated for pioneering the Arabic pop music genre known as "Al-Jil." His innovative fusion of Arabic music with international styles has earned him a massive following across the Arab world and beyond. With numerous awards and chart-topping hits to his name, he remains one of the most influential figures in the contemporary music scene. His career, spanning several decades, has made him a household name and a cultural icon in the Middle East.

Early Life & Education

Amr Diab was born on October 11, 1961, in Port Said, Egypt, into a family where music was highly valued. His father, who worked for the Suez Canal Corporation, was a significant influence, encouraging Diab's passion for music from an early age. He first sang the national anthem on Egyptian radio at the age of six, marking the beginning of his musical journey. Diab later pursued his education at the Cairo Academy of Arts, where he honed his skills and laid the foundation for his future career in music.

Career Highlights

His career took off in the mid-1980s after releasing his first studio album, "Ya Tareeq," which showcased his distinctive voice and musical style. Over the years, he released numerous albums that consistently topped charts, such as "Nour El Ain" in 1996, which gained international acclaim. Known for his ability to innovate and adapt, Diab frequently collaborated with international artists and producers, further expanding his musical repertoire. His successful career has earned him numerous accolades, including several World Music Awards, cementing his status as a global music icon.

Major Achievements

  • World Music Awards: Diab has won several World Music Awards for Best Selling Middle Eastern Artist.
  • Record Sales: He has sold over 30 million albums worldwide, making him one of the best-selling Middle Eastern artists.
  • Iconic Songs: His song "Nour El Ain" is considered one of the most popular Arabic songs globally.
  • Innovative Style: Credited with popularizing the "Al-Jil" music genre, blending Arabic and Western musical elements.

Interesting Facts

  • Diab was the first Arabic artist to receive a World Music Award.
  • He holds a Guinness World Record for being the top Arab artist with the most World Music Awards.
  • Diab's music has been featured in international films, further boosting his global presence.

Legacy / Influence

Amr Diab's legacy is marked by his innovative approach to music, which has significantly influenced the Arabic music industry. His fusion of Western and Middle Eastern sounds paved the way for future artists, expanding the global reach of Arabic pop music. Diab's enduring popularity and numerous accolades underscore his impact on music and culture, making him a pivotal figure in the landscape of contemporary Arabic entertainment.
